Collecting data on sexual violence: what do we need to know? The case of MSF in the Democratic Republic of Congo

Claire Magone has published a paper, in Humanitarian Exchange Magazine (issue 60, February 2014 ) focusing on gender-based violence (GBV) in humanitarian crises. In an article called "Collecting data on sexual violence: what do we need to know? The case of MSF in the Democratic Republic of Congo", she cautions against an over-emphasis on collecting prevalence data over addressing victims' needs. Humanitarian Exchange Magazine - 2 Feb 2014

Médecins Sans Frontières (MSF)

Independent medical humanitarian assistance

We provide medical assistance to people affected by conflict, epidemics, disasters, or exclusion from healthcare. Our teams are made up of tens of thousands of health professionals, logistic and administrative staff - most of them hired locally. Our actions are guided by medical ethics and the principles of independence and impartiality. We are a non-profit, self-governed, member-based organisation.
